Transaction 4aacd5821fdc91250594e39037986904459703a8cf175966d66aaf66a75ed11e
1 Input
1 Output
-
4aacd5821fdc91250594e39037986904459703a8cf175966d66aaf66a75ed11e:0
- value
- 2268743
- script pubkey
- OP_0 OP_PUSHBYTES_20 3466c1186c200eba03283d81580cde4c4a503349
- address
- bc1qx3nvzxrvyq8t5qeg8kq4srx7f399qv6fhv47ea